探索 Kubean:集群生命周期管理的革新者
项目介绍
:seedling: Kubean —— 打造 Kubernetes 的未来
Kubean 是一款基于 kubespray 开发的强大集群生命周期管理工具。它不仅提供了一种声明式的 API 来轻松管理 K8s 集群的部署和运维,而且内置了离线支持,确保在各种环境下的无缝使用。Kubean 荣获 云原生计算基金会 (CNCF) 认证,兼容多种架构,是现代企业管理和扩展 Kubernetes 集群的理想选择。
项目技术分析
:wrench: 技术核心,助力高效运维
-
声明式 API:Kubean 的核心在于其简单易用的声明式 API,使得用户可以专注于描述他们想要的结果,而无需关心实现细节。
-
离线支持:每个版本都包含了完整的离线包,包括系统软件包、镜像和二进制文件,即使在网络受限的环境中也能保证正常运行。
-
跨平台兼容:支持 AMD 和 ARM 架构,以及包括常见 Linux 发行版和基于鲲鹏的麒麟操作系统的多种环境。
-
灵活扩展:Kubean 基于 Kubespray,这意味着你可以利用 Kubespray 的自定义功能来构建符合特定需求的集群。
应用场景
:rocket: 应用于广泛的生产环境
Kubean 凭借其出色的技术特性,适用于以下场景:
-
敏捷开发与测试:快速部署和销毁 K8s 集群,简化开发与测试流程。
-
多云与边缘计算:在不同的公有云、私有云以及边缘设备上部署和维护 K8s 集群。
-
企业级运维:为大型企业提供可靠、高效的集群管理解决方案,以应对复杂的 IT 架构。
项目特点
:star: 引人注目的亮点
-
简单易用:只需要几次简单的命令,就能完成集群的部署、更新和删除操作。
-
快速上手:借助在线平台 killercoda 上的交互式教程,初学者也可以快速掌握。
-
高度兼容:与多个 Kubernetes 版本无缝配合,确保持续的稳定性。
-
全面文档:详尽的参考文档帮助用户深入理解和使用 Kubean。
-
社区活跃:作为 CNCF 项目,Kubean 拥有活跃的开发者社区,不断推进项目的进化和完善。
探索 Kubean,体验前所未有的集群管理效率。无论您是经验丰富的 DevOps 工程师还是 Kubernetes 的新手,Kubean 都能为您提供卓越的集群生命周期管理服务。立即加入,一起迈向云原生的新纪元!